You stand in a hallway with doors to three different rooms. In each room there is a lightbulb. In front of the room you have three switches, each lighst one lightbulb. When you get in the hallway all lights are turned off. Before you open the doors you can play with the switches as much as you want, but once you open the doors (all togheter), you must not use the switches anymore. offcourse you can't peek in the rooms or something silly like that.
Find a way to tell which switch lights the lightbulb in which room.
I turn 1 lightbulb on for some time, turn it off and then turn the next one on and go into the rooms.
one room is gonna have a turned on lightbulb
other room is gonna have a cold and turned off lightbulb
the third room is gonna have a warm and off lightbulb
